Most pennies are worth 1 cent, but to coin collectors, some are worth more …In 2011, the 2009 S PR 70 DCAM Lincoln-Early Childhood (Log Cabin) penny reached $440 at Great Collections. In 2022, the 2009 No Mint mark SP 69 RD Lincoln-Early Childhood (Log Cabin) penny with a satin finish reached $112 on eBay. In 2021, the 2009 D SP 69 RD Lincoln-Early Childhood (Log Cabin) penny with a satin finish reached $105 on eBay.

The 2009 zinc pennies are each worth around $0.50 in uncirculated condition with an MS 65 grade. The 2009 copper pennies with the satin finish are each worth around $10 in uncirculated condition with an MS 65 grade. Feb 10, 2022 · The penny was one of the first coins made by the U.S. Mint after its establishment in 1792. The design on the first penny was of a woman with flowing hair symbolizing liberty. The coin was larger and made of pure copper, while today’s smaller coin is made of copper and zinc. Liberty stayed on the penny for more than 60 years. Fun Facts . Just as the U.S. has thirteen original colonies, E Pluribus Unum has thirteen letters in it. The Mint made the first dimes in 1796. They were small silver coins. The designs from 1796 to 1837 showed Liberty on the obverse and an eagle on the reverse. In 1837, a wreath design replaced the eagle. Liberty, in various forms, stayed on the dime until 1946.
